3.2 Learning by experience It's a familiar idea but it implies two activities: learning and experiencing. Both activities need to happen if I am to say that learning from experience has happened. Experiencing seems to have two components. The first is the quality of attention that allows me to notice the experience and its components. The second is memory. This video clip is the sixth episode in the Principles of the Constitution Mini-Series. This clip focuses on the second half of the Bill of Rights, also known as the first ten Amendments to the Constitution. It was at the Constitutional Convention were James Madison created the Bill of Rights. Madison borrowed ideas from the Virginia Declaration of Rights, the English Bill of Rights, and the Enlightenment. Is there liquid water on Mars? By experimenting with water as it changes state and investigating some effects of air pressure, students not only learn core ideas in physical science but can deduce the water situation on Mars by applying those concepts.

Introduce elementary students to the concept of functions by investigating growing patterns. Visual patterns formed with manipulatives are especially effective for elementary students and allow them to concretely build understanding as they first reproduce, then extend the pattern to the next couple of stages.
